So, what is ulei?
Ulei is a traditional ingredient used in many dishes around the world. Also known as oil, this ingredient is a key component of many cuisines due to its versatility and unique flavor. Ulei is derived from various sources, including olives, coconut, sunflowers, and many others. Each type of ulei has its own distinct properties, making it a valuable addition to any kitchen. It can be used for frying, sautéing, dressing salads, and much more. With its many health benefits and diverse applications, ulei is an essential ingredient for any culinary enthusiast looking to add depth and richness to their meals.
